The Valley View Cinemas opened at 95th & Antioch in May 1972 with a reserved seat engagement of "Nicholas and Alexandria" that ran for five months. Designed by Curtis & Associates Architects of Kansas City, Missouri, each theater held 310 seats.

Commonwealth Theatres took over operations in 1977 from owners Charles Fisher and Ronald Graves.

The cinemas were closed in 1985 and converted into a banquet hall.
